Catatonic signs and symptoms appear in a number of medical and psychiatric disorders. Therefore, having these manifestations doesn’t mean a person necessarily has schizophrenia. And there are no blood or brain-imaging tests that can be used to make a diagnosis of schizophrenia.

A complete diagnostic workup includes both general medical and psychiatric assessments. A diagnosis of catatonic schizophrenia indicates that the catatonic symptoms are dominant, the person has other symptoms of schizophrenia and the symptoms can’t be attributed to other disorders.
